Does MS go into remission and if it does how do you know?

In recurring/remittant MS is does indeed go into remission. You know because you have full sensation everywhere, your eyes work just fine, and you aren't feeling confused about the little things anymore. If you start to question whether you actually DO have MS, then its in remission..
